The Double Life Of Veronique

Two women with identical looks, birthdates and names unknowingly have their lives inter-connected in this beautifully crafted thriller. When one of the women dies, a puppeteer familiar with both Veroniques tries to uncover the mystery behind her death. Irene Jacob, who won Best Actress at the Cannes Film Festival, plays the dual title role.
